Output 72e33bd829e1e0c126196653b54604f58f0006db4335eea4f14230ae02f26867:1

value
10042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f03b6c36f8077129941d853b0d0fffeac77f95 OP_EQUAL
address
3CXuSoMfYkqLy53icq52TPhhzky4egBoV9
transaction
72e33bd829e1e0c126196653b54604f58f0006db4335eea4f14230ae02f26867
spent
true